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 3 of 3 for createCNIConfigFile (0.18 sec)

  1. cni/pkg/install/cniconfig_test.go

    		})
    	}
    }
    
    const (
    	// For testing purposes, set kubeconfigFilename equivalent to the path in the test files and use __KUBECONFIG_FILENAME__
    	// CreateCNIConfigFile joins the MountedCNINetDir and KubeconfigFilename if __KUBECONFIG_FILEPATH__ was used
    	kubeconfigFilename   = "/path/to/kubeconfig"
    	cniNetworkConfigFile = "testdata/istio-cni.conf.template"
    	cniNetworkConfig     = `{
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Tue May 21 18:32:01 UTC 2024
    - 15.4K bytes
    - Viewed (0)
  2. cni/pkg/install/cniconfig.go

    	"strings"
    
    	"github.com/containernetworking/cni/libcni"
    
    	"istio.io/istio/cni/pkg/config"
    	"istio.io/istio/cni/pkg/plugin"
    	"istio.io/istio/cni/pkg/util"
    	"istio.io/istio/pkg/file"
    )
    
    func createCNIConfigFile(ctx context.Context, cfg *config.InstallConfig) (string, error) {
    	pluginConfig := plugin.Config{
    		PluginLogLevel:  cfg.PluginLogLevel,
    		LogUDSAddress:   cfg.LogUDSAddress,
    		CNIEventAddress: cfg.CNIEventAddress,
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Tue May 21 18:32:01 UTC 2024
    - 8.3K bytes
    - Viewed (0)
  3. cni/pkg/install/install.go

    	if err := checkValidCNIConfig(in.cfg, in.cniConfigFilepath); err != nil {
    		installLog.Infof("missing (or invalid) configuration detected, (re)writing CNI config file at %s", in.cniConfigFilepath)
    		cfgPath, err := createCNIConfigFile(ctx, in.cfg)
    		if err != nil {
    			cniInstalls.With(resultLabel.Value(resultCreateCNIConfigFailure)).Increment()
    			return copiedFiles, fmt.Errorf("create CNI config file: %v", err)
    		}
    		in.cniConfigFilepath = cfgPath
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Fri May 31 21:45:18 UTC 2024
    - 10.7K bytes
    - Viewed (0)
Back to top